MSI Sword 17 (A12UD) review – does the low price justify the compromises?
If there is a brand known for its gaming devices, this surely has to be MSI. Its gamut consists of budget machines, premium laptops, and everything in between. Today, we are going to review a gaming notebook, which sits closer to the first part of the brand’s portfolio.
It is the MSI Sword 17 (A12UD). Interestingly, this particular notebook can be found by the (A12UDX) and (A12UCX). The last two come with DDR5 RAM and two M.2 slots on the inside, while the one we have, has DDR4 memory, and only one storage slot.
Regardless of that, our particular configuration features the Intel Core i7-12700H. It is one of the most powerful CPUs from the outgoing 12th generation by Team Blue. As for the graphics, you get the RTX 3050 Ti with a 60W TGP.
To be frank, this machine is very similar to the MSI Katana GF76, but we can say that it is specialized for one particular genre of games – RPG. These are the words of the manufacturer, not ours. We think the laptops are essentially the same.

What’s in the box?
Inside the box, you will get the mandatory paperwork, as well as a 180W charger.
